80 CLASS 
Road Numbers8001-8050
BuilderCommonwealth Engineering Granville
ModelCE615A
EngineAlco 12-251CE
Gauge1435mm Standard
WheelsCo-Co
Power1605kW / 2150HP
Length19000mm
Mass 122t
